How Our Team Removes Water from Laundry Rooms
When you call us, our team will arrive quickly to assess the damage and develop a customized plan to remove the water and dry your laundry room. Here’s what you can expect:
Initial Assessment
Our technicians will inspect your laundry room, taking note of the extent of the damage, the source of the leak, and the type of flooring and walls involved. They’ll also check for signs of mold and mildew growth.
Water Extraction
Using commercial-grade water extraction units, our team will remove the standing water from your laundry room, including the floor, walls, and any affected furniture.
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ized drying equipment to remove moisture from your walls, floors, and ceilings, and dehumidifiers to control the humidity levels in your home.
Moisture Detection and Measurement
Our technicians will use specialized tools to detect and measure moisture levels in your walls, floors, and ceilings, ensuring that every inch of your home is dry and safe.
Disinfection and Sanitizing
Once the water and moisture have been removed, we’ll disinfect and sanitize your laundry room to prevent the growth of mold and mildew.

Warning Signs You Need Laundry Room Water Removal
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your laundry room, it’s likely a sign of mold and mildew growth. This can lead to serious health problems and costly repairs if left unchecked.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
If your flooring is warped or buckled, it’s a sign that the water has damaged the underlying structure. This can lead to costly repairs and even compromise the structural integrity of your home.
Stains or Water Marks on Walls or Ceilings
If you notice stains or water marks on your walls or ceilings, it’s a sign that the water has penetrated the surface. This can lead to mold and mildew growth, and even compromise the structural integrity of your home.
Visible Water Stains or Leaks

Laundry Room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ak, less than 1 gallon of water | Yes | No | You can likely handle a small leak with some towels and a wet/dry vacuum. |
| Large leak, over 1 gallon of water | No | Yes | A large leak needs specialized equipment and expertise to remove the water and prevent further damage. |
| Visible water stains or leaks | No | Yes | Visible water stains or leaks show that the water has penetrated the surface and needs professional attention to prevent mold and mildew growth. |
| M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ew growth need specialized equipment and expertise to remove and prevent further growth. |
| High humidity levels | No | Yes | High humidity levels can create an ideal environment for mold and mildew growth, needing professional attention to control and prevent. |
| Unpleasant odors or stains | No | Yes | Unpleasant odors or stains show that the water has created an ideal environment for mold and mildew growth, needing professional attention to remove and prevent further growth. |
